SPECIES Artibeus (Dermanura) cinereus

Author:Gervais, 1856.
Citation:In Comte de Castelnau, Exped. Partes Cen. Am. Sud., Zool. (Sec. 7), Vol. 1(pt. 2 (Mammifères)): 36.
Common Name:Gervais's Fruit-eating Bat
Type Locality:Brazil, Pará, Belem.
Distribution:Guianas, Venezuela, N Brazil, Peru, Trinidad.
Status:IUCN 2003 and IUCN/SSC Action Plan (2001) – Lower Risk (lc).
Comments:Subgenus Dermanura. Does not include gnomus or glaucus; see Handley (1987).
